WebHere’s some basic information about what’s normal and what’s not. Temperature. A normal rectal temperature for a newborn puppy is 95 to 99 degrees Fahrenheit for the first week, and 97 to 100 for the second week. By the fourth week, the puppy’s temperature should reach the normal temperature of an adult dog: 100 to 102 degrees. WebMar 7, 2011 · 1. Even after your dog has settled into your home, they’ll always be the most comfortable when they have an area that’s all theirs. When they first arrive, they’ll use their “spot” as a place to escape all the newness of their situation.

Some scared dogs will feel more comfortable approaching you if you kneel with your side or back to the dog, rather than approaching a dog head on. This indirect approach is more “polite” in dog culture. reached its maximumWebOct 6, 2024 · To call a dog yours, some counties require that you report that you found a dog within 24 to 48 hours of finding the dog to the local law or animal control agency.
